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20507381322 25502 79619774
4176646 8434679 6986
4176646 8434679 6986
44576790 6400698978 90338141265
All about undefined
Interested in learning more?
4176646 8434679 6986
44576790 6400698978 90338141265
See more
812726398 23315372008
28 933 9153 70 4904793340
See more
743 9935
922 8519017 488 81352
See more